Backend Java Engineer
Location: Chicago
Posted on: June 23, 2025
|
|
Job Description:
Date Posted: 06/18/2025 Hiring Organization: Rose International
Position Number: 484357 Industry: Manufacturing Job Title: Backend
Java Engineer Job Location: Chicago, IL, USA, 60603 Work Model:
Onsite Shift: 8am to 4:30pm, 5 days a week Employment Type:
Temporary FT/PT: Full-Time Estimated Duration (In months): 10 Min
Hourly Rate ($): 75.00 Max Hourly Rate ($): 85.00 Must Have
Skills/Attributes: Agile, AWS, Azure, Java, Jenkins, Kafka,
Microservices, MongoDB, Selenium Experience Desired: Modify
existing Java software, create services, and write unit/integration
(12 yrs); Design microservices, event-driven architectures, and
RESTful APIs. (12 yrs); Deploy via CI/CD pipelines (Jenkins, Azure
DevOps). (12 yrs) Required Minimum Education: Bachelor’s Degree
Preferred Education: Master’s Degree Job Description Required
Education • Bachelor’s degree in computer science, Electrical
Engineering, or related field. Preferred Education • Master’s
degree (reduces required experience to 6 years). Required Skills •
8 years (or 6 with Master’s) of software development experience. •
Java 17 (designing, developing, deploying at scale). •
Cloud/DevOps: AWS/Azure, CI/CD (Jenkins, Azure DevOps). •
Databases: Relational (MySQL, Oracle) and NoSQL (DynamoDB, MongoDB,
Cassandra). • API Development: RESTful APIs, Swagger/Postman. •
Testing: TDD/BDD, Selenium, Cucumber. • CS Fundamentals: Data
structures, algorithms. • Agile/Scrum experience. Preferred Skills
• Message Streaming: Kafka, RabbitMQ, AWS Kinesis/SQS/SNS. • AWS
Services: Lambda, Fargate, API Gateway, CloudWatch. • Debugging in
Linux/Unix environments. Job Responsibilities • Modify existing
Java software, create services, and write unit/integration tests. •
Design microservices, event-driven architectures, and RESTful APIs.
• Deploy via CI/CD pipelines (Jenkins, Azure DevOps). • Maintain
software on AWS/Azure (e.g., Lambda, S3, DynamoDB). • Work in
Agile/Scrum teams, mentor junior engineers. • Troubleshoot issues,
including off-shift/weekend support. • Enforce coding standards and
best practices. • Lead small-to-medium projects with minimal
supervision. Only those lawfully authorized to work in the
designated country associated with the position will be considered.
Please note that all Position start dates and duration are
estimates and may be reduced or lengthened based upon a client’s
business needs and requirements. Benefits: For information and
details on employment benefits offered with this position, please
visit here. Should you have any questions/concerns, please contact
our HR Department via our secure website. California Pay Equity:
For information and details on pay equity laws in California,
please visit the State of California Department of Industrial
Relations' website here.
Keywords: , Downers Grove , Backend Java Engineer, IT / Software / Systems , Chicago, Illinois